The change expanded the accepted target architecture for VS builds with
`AARCH64` option, which will output native Windows ARM64 binaries.

Note that the warnings due to integer conversions are suppressed for
this specific target to avoid too much local changes carried in MU. The
formal change should drop all these binaries and move to pythonic
scripts.

# MU_CHANGE Starts: Adding support to build base tools for ARM
# MU_CHANGE Starts: Adding support to build base tools for ARM and AARCH64
!ELSEIF "$(HOST_ARCH)"=="ARM"
ARCH_INCLUDE = $(EDK2_PATH)\MdePkg\Include\Arm
BIN_PATH = $(BASE_TOOLS_PATH)\Bin\Win32
LIB_PATH = $(BASE_TOOLS_PATH)\Lib\Win32
SYS_BIN_PATH = $(EDK_TOOLS_PATH)\Bin\Win32
SYS_LIB_PATH = $(EDK_TOOLS_PATH)\Lib\Win32
!ELSEIF "$(HOST_ARCH)"=="AARCH64"
ARCH_INCLUDE = $(EDK2_PATH)\MdePkg\Include\AArch64
BIN_PATH = $(BASE_TOOLS_PATH)\Bin\Win64
LIB_PATH = $(BASE_TOOLS_PATH)\Lib\Win64
SYS_BIN_PATH = $(EDK_TOOLS_PATH)\Bin\Win64
SYS_LIB_PATH = $(EDK_TOOLS_PATH)\Lib\Win64
# Note: These are bit-width conversion related warning suppressions we carry to avoid much more
# overrides in the C code. The future plan is to replace all of these binary based tools
# with python scripts, when it happens in tianocore..
CFLAGS = $(CFLAGS) /wd4267 /wd4244 /wd4334
# MU_CHANGE Ends
